Evaporator Leak Verification in a W124

Hello,

I have an AC leak in my W124. I put some die in with a charge and can't find a leak. I know the evaporator is a big problem in the W125s. How do I verify it without tearing the dash off? Should I be able to see a leak if I take the blower motor cover off? Are there condensate drains that would have oil or die leaking out of them?

It's unlikely you will see dye when pulling the blower motor. Portions of the evap can be inspected, but not everything. The most likely leak locations - solder points between the many copper elbows and the aluminum core - are not visible.

I suggest looking at the condensate. Wait until the performance of the system degrades, then take a look. You need enough dye to leak out to be detectable.
